## Configuration

Heads up, reviewer: Quillforge caches compiled templates in-process, so render times drop from ~40ms to sub-millisecond after warmup. The cache key includes the template hash, not user input, so no injection path there. We did add a signed cache-bust token so ops can flush renders remotely without restarting workers — that's the one secret worth your attention. It lives in `.env.production`, never in the repo. Add the token line right below this sentence.

sealed setting: VAULT_KEY20=69e2a0b23f1a79fbf692

Ticket: Staging env misconfigured for Siftgate bloom filter

The bloom layer in front of the Pellet KV store is rejecting all lookups in staging because the env file was copied from the dev template without credentials. False-positive tuning values are fine; only the auth line is missing. To unblock the weekly demo, the Pellet admission secret must be set on the following line.

env line for yaguf-fajop: LEDGER_TOKEN13=fb08984397349

Management Meeting Minutes — Velmora Expansion

Attendees: all department heads.

Discussion centred on the proposed push into the Velmora region. Tomas presented demand modelling — stronger than expected in the coastal corridor. Ops flagged warehousing as the main bottleneck; a short-term lease in Port Ashen is being scoped. Agreed to target a soft launch next quarter, pending finance sign-off. HR to begin quiet recruitment locally. Strictly for this group, the chair added:

internal memo for hahif-hahaf: Headcount on the Zorwyn team goes from 9 to 100 by the end of October. Gross margin on Zorwyn came in at 5 percent against a plan of 10 percent.

## Changelog — Fieldnote Surveyor 4.2: Offline Mode Defaults

Offline mode is now enabled by default for all new installs. Previously, surveyors in low-coverage regions like the Darrowfen basin had to toggle it manually, and unsaved plots were lost on signal drop. Sync now queues locally and retries with exponential backoff once connectivity returns. Storage quotas were raised to accommodate a full week of plot data. Existing installs keep their old settings until the next forced update. The new default configuration values are listed below.

settings of tajep-tafog:
CASDOR_LOG_LEVEL=info
CASDOR_METRICS_HOST=metrics.casdor.nelvrosys.internal
CASDOR_POOL_SIZE=16